Death Row Facts


Number on Death Row:  90
Numbers Breakdown: 88 males and 2 females
50 White, 37 African Americans, 1 Hispanics, 1 Native American, 1 Asian

Where are they from?
58 inmates are from the largest metropolitan counties of
Shelby(35), Davidson (12), Knox (6), and Hamilton (4)

25 inmates were convicted in East Tennessee
24 inmates were convicted in Middle Tennessee
41 inmates were convicted in West Tennessee

Oldest on Death Row:
John Henretta, 2/12/43, 65 years old
Convicted in Bradley County
On Death Row since April 2002

Youngest Female on Death Row:
Christa Pike, 3/10/76, 32 years old
Convicted in Knox County
On Death Row since March 1996

Youngest Male on Death Row:
Devin Banks, 8/2/83, 24 years old
Convicted in Shelby County
On Death Row since April 2005

Longest Time on Death Row:
Donald Strouth, 1/09/59, 49 years old
Convicted in Sullivan County
On Death Row since September 1978

Last Person Sentence to Death Row:
Nickolus Johnson, 7/06/78, 29 years old
Convicted in Sullivan County
On Death Row since April, 2007

Most male inmates are housed at Riverbend Maximum Security Institution in Nashville, but for security reasons, some of them can be housed at the Brushy Mountain Correctional Complex in Morgan County.  Two inmates with the death penalty are currently housed at Brushy Mountain.

Female inmates sentenced to death are housed at the Tennessee Prison for Women in  Nashville.

The following number of inmates have multiple death sentences:  13 inmates with two death sentences, five inmates with three death sentences, and one inmate with seven death sentences.
